300sx 650 pump/motor conversion

figured i would take some pictures.


so far:
shortened hand pole 2 3/4"
650sx pump
650TS motor
filled front engine bay breather
500gph bilge


still to do:
x2 trim on its way
side exhaust outlet
pump cone
bore nozzle
quicksteer plate
bars
turf tray and rails

and countless engine things.

Re: 300sx 650 pump/motor conversion

How did you get the 650 pump in there??? Pictures please.

Re: 300sx 650 pump/motor conversion

i don't have any pictures of that but it was a lot of work. i sectioned the pump tunnel out of a 650ts and the cut the tunnel and tray floor out of the 300 and glassed it in re foamed the inside then ran carriage bolts through the deck to act as studs for the pump.

Re: 300sx 650 pump/motor conversion

That is going to be interesting with the engine set back that far, I ended up using a 750SXI driveshaft on mine to set the engine forward, you have a serious risk of being way too nose light on that ski, if backflips are what you are going for you are on the right track though.

Re: 300sx 650 pump/motor conversion

I understand clearance gets tight running the longer shaft as I have , I built mine for my son and wanted it well balanced and ridable for him, moving the steering forward is probably the best thing you could do on that ski, mine is moved forward about three inches.
